从键盘事件中捕获日语字母

时间:2018-06-18 10:42:17

标签: java keyboard-events jna cjk

我使用“kwhat / jnativehook”(适用于Java的全局键盘和鼠标侦听器。) 捕获全局键盘事件。

我已使用Windows IME将键盘语言更改为日语。但我仍然从 NativeKeyEvent

收到英文字母
public void nativeKeyTyped(NativeKeyEvent e) {

    System.out.println(e.getKeyChar());
    displayEventInfo(e);
}

任何想法捕捉使用键盘解雇的日语字母。

提前致谢。

0 个答案:

没有答案